WebChew on the opposite side of your mouth as the extraction. After a few days, gradually begin to chew on both sides. Begin cleaning the teeth next to the extracted tooth site. Gently rinse your mouth with saltwater after meals to help keep the healing tooth socket clean. Resist playing with the healing gum, which could disrupt the clot and cause ... WebWhy do I still have pain 5 days after wisdom teeth removal? Dry socket It's where a blood clot fails to develop in the tooth socket, or if the blood clot becomes dislodged or disappears. This can happen 3 to 5 days after surgery. The empty socket causes an ache or throbbing pain in your gum or jaw, which can be intense like a toothache.
